WebShort-term Goals: ** cues for attention, initiation, voicing, forced choice, phonemic/semantic cueing, gestural/contextual cues, specificity, attention to … WebPossible treatment targets include the use of compensatory strategies for swallowing, safe transfer techniques, the names of caregivers, and the use of memory aids (e.g. schedules and calendars). Achievement of these goals can promote independence and reduce anxiety, as well as improve interactions between the client and clinician or caregiver. company house how to change business address https://christophertorrez.com
